Xbox One updates to continue in February

by on15 January 2015


More ability to customize your home screen

Microsoft plans to start the next round of update to the Xbox One in February. The plans for the February pack of updates include a number of updates, but perhaps the biggest news is the addition of “tile transparency” which allows you to see more of your custom background.

The new update will also bring the new “Game Hubs” which collate stays on your progress through a game, leaderboards, Achievement info, DLC details and Twitch video from your friends and the community.

A new trending tab will be a welcome addition to those who use their Xbox One with cable TV or the console’s TV tuner. The trending tab will show you which shows are currently the most popular to make watching decisions easier if you just can’t figure out what to watch.

A new feature will allow the streaming of a live TV stream to your Windows Phone or Android, but only if you happen to have the TV Tuner peripheral, which is currently only available outside North America.
